Top 41 Backpackers in India
List of top verified Backpackers in India, near me. Last updated Dec 2024
We found 41 directory listings in India. Page 3
Amrapali Packers Movers in Thanesar
Address: 340 , arpan society , balkum, Titlagarh, Maharashtra, India
Verified+8 Years with us
9784897907
2015 Established
Website